Genetic diversity in performance per se and economic heterosis among newly developed A1 cytoplasmic male sterile lines and restorers in pearl millet.

A study was undertaken to assess the diversity among newly developed downy mildew-resistant A1 cytoplasmic male sterile lines (CMS) and restorers in terms of their performance per se in hybrid combination for a range of agronomic traits in pearl millet. The results of range of mean, genotypic variance for yield and yield attributing characters indicated the presence of sufficient genetic diversity among CMS lines and restorers. Sixteen hybrids exhibited significantly positive economic heterosis for grain yield per plant and also for other yield components. From this study, it is apparent that there is sufficient variability present among newly developed restorers and CMS lines to produce a range of genetically diverse hybrids with high grain yield.
